Data Exfiltration (Agent)

Data exfiltration via AI agents occurs when an agent, whether compromised or misconfigured, transmits sensitive data to an unauthorised destination. Agents are particularly high-risk exfiltration vectors because they routinely access internal systems, process sensitive data, and make outbound API calls — all of which can be exploited if access controls and output monitoring are insufficient.
